Grinding Noise When Starting And Stopping?
had message cyan cartridge was causing it. changed it but noise still occurs
Current Answers
Answer #1: Posted by waelsaidani1 on January 23rd, 2015 2:18 PM
A grinding sound is heard when the printer is turned on or when it is printing. Blinking lights may accompany the noise. The problem can be caused by a carriage stall or a paper jam. To resolve this issue, follow the instructions here.https://support.hp.com/us-en/document/c00255558
